Output ab2436f83fa6ec4dcc635f3147ec4b2f34b18dc59ada43482dfa7e5ca22e06bd:1

value
986262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c07d65fbd0a4e6e7bb89734720bae63dfe0f85fe OP_EQUAL
address
3KEotCxQNpv2g3jq2KgwUAvgR3RjeuB2RH
transaction
ab2436f83fa6ec4dcc635f3147ec4b2f34b18dc59ada43482dfa7e5ca22e06bd
confirmations
354868
spent
true